This restaurant is a typical Greek style diners, no decor whatsoever, but the food is fresh & good.
We were 4 people on a busy Saturday night, place was packed with mostly Greek diners, which is a sign the food is authentic & good.
It’s a family style dining experience, where you order several dishes for everyone to share.
Appetizers: Octopus was good, Calamars also good, fried Zucchini were okay but too much batter & oily, the Tzatziki sauce was really thick & light , not too much garlic, simply delicious. The Greek salad was also very fresh & good.
We ordered a kilo of lamb for our main course; it was really good & more than enough for four people...with all the entrees & bread/tzatziki, this was plenty of food.
dessert: Loukomades ,which are fried pastry dough balls drizzled with Honey , warm & delicious.
Wine list was okay, prices were extremely reasonable, some starting at $30-$40
Price wise, it is very reasonable, approx $150 per couple with tax & tip.
I would recommend it for a casual night out with friends that have good appetites.
